Převod FODS do PPTX pomocí GroupDocs.Conversion .NET: Komplexní průvodce

Zavedení

Máte potíže s ručním převodem souborů FODS do prezentací v PowerPointu? Tento zdlouhavý úkol může být časově náročný a náchylný k chybám. Naštěstí knihovna GroupDocs.Conversion pro .NET nabízí bezproblémové řešení. Díky svým robustním funkcím je transformace vašich dokumentů FODS do formátu PPTX rychlá a efektivní.

V tomto tutoriálu se naučíte, jak pomocí nástroje GroupDocs.Conversion for .NET snadno převést soubory FODS do prezentací v PowerPointu. Zde je to, co probereme:

  • Co se naučíte:
    • Nastavení GroupDocs.Conversion pro .NET
    • Převod souborů FODS do PPTX pomocí C#
    • Praktické aplikace a tipy pro výkon

Jste připraveni zefektivnit proces převodu dokumentů? Pojďme se ponořit do nezbytných předpokladů, než začnete.

Předpoklady

Než začneme s převodem vašich souborů FODS, ujistěte se, že je vše správně nastaveno:

  • Požadované knihovny: Ujistěte se, že je nainstalován nástroj GroupDocs.Conversion pro .NET (verze 25.3.0 nebo novější).
  • Nastavení prostředí: Tento tutoriál předpokládá základní znalost jazyka C# a nastavení prostředí .NET.
  • Předpoklady znalostí: Znalost práce se soubory v C# bude výhodou.

Nastavení GroupDocs.Conversion pro .NET

Chcete-li začít, budete muset nainstalovat knihovnu GroupDocs.Conversion. Můžete to provést buď pomocí konzole NuGet Package Manager, nebo pomocí rozhraní .NET CLI:

Konzola Správce balíčků NuGet:

Install-Package GroupDocs.Conversion -Version 25.3.0

\Rozhraní příkazového řádku .NET:

dotnet add package GroupDocs.Conversion --version 25.3.0

Získání licence

Chcete-li používat GroupDocs.Conversion, začněte s bezplatnou zkušební verzí, abyste si otestovali její funkce. Pokud vyhovuje vašim potřebám, zvažte zakoupení licence nebo pořízení dočasné licence pro delší používání.

Základní inicializace a nastavení v C#

Zde je návod, jak nastavit základní inicializaci:

using System;
using GroupDocs.Conversion;

class Program
{
    static void Main()
    {
        // Inicializujte obslužnou rutinu převodu s konfigurací vaší aplikace.
        string licensePath = "@YOUR_LICENSE_PATH";
        License lic = new License();
        lic.SetLicense(licensePath);

        Console.WriteLine("GroupDocs.Conversion is set up and ready to use!");
    }
}

Průvodce implementací

Nyní si projdeme kroky potřebné k převodu souborů FODS do formátu PPTX.

Načtěte soubor FODS a převeďte jej

  1. Přehled: Tato funkce umožňuje načíst dokument FODS a přímo jej převést do prezentace v PowerPointu (PPTX).

  2. Možnosti převodu nastavení: Nejprve zadejte výstupní adresář, kam bude převedený soubor uložen:

    string outputFolder = "@YOUR_OUTPUT_DIRECTORY"; // Nahraďte svou cestou
    
  3. Implementujte konverzní logiku:

    Zde je návod, jak převést soubor FODS na PPTX pomocí nástroje GroupDocs.Conversion:

    using System;
    using System.IO;
    using GroupDocs.Conversion;
    using GroupDocs.Conversion.Options.Convert;
    
    class Program
    {
        static void Main()
        {
            string outputFolder = "@YOUR_OUTPUT_DIRECTORY"; // Nahraďte svou cestou
            string outputFile = Path.Combine(outputFolder, "fods-converted-to.pptx");
    
            // Inicializujte objekt převodníku pomocí souboru FODS.
            using (var converter = new GroupDocs.Conversion.Converter("@YOUR_DOCUMENT_DIRECTORY\\sample.fods"))
            {
                var options = new PresentationConvertOptions(); // Vytvořte možnosti převodu pro formát PPTX
    
                // Převeďte a uložte výstupní soubor
                converter.Convert(outputFile, options);
            }
        }
    }
    
    • Vysvětlení parametrů:
      • outputFile je cesta, kam bude uložena převedená prezentace.
      • PresentationConvertOptions() nastaví převod do formátu PPTX.
  4. Tipy pro řešení problémů:

    • Ujistěte se, že jsou cesty pro vstupní i výstupní soubory správně nastaveny.
    • Ověřte, zda máte potřebná oprávnění ke čtení a zápisu do zadaných adresářů.

Praktické aplikace

Integrace GroupDocs.Conversion do vašich .NET aplikací otevírá řadu možností:

  • Automatizované generování reportů: Převádějte zprávy uložené ve formátu FODS přímo do prezentací pro snadné sdílení.
  • Správa vzdělávacího obsahu: Transformujte vzdělávací materiály do prezentací v PowerPointu pro použití ve třídě.
  • Příprava obchodních jednání: Rychle připravte balíčky snímek z archivů dokumentů.

Úvahy o výkonu

Pro zajištění optimálního výkonu při používání GroupDocs.Conversion:

  • Optimalizace využití zdrojů: Soubory převádějte pouze v nezbytných případech, abyste minimalizovali spotřebu zdrojů.
  • Nejlepší postupy pro správu paměti: Správně likvidujte zdroje pomocí using příkazy v C#, aby se zabránilo únikům paměti.

Závěr

Nyní jste zvládli, jak převádět dokumenty FODS do prezentací PPTX pomocí nástroje GroupDocs.Conversion pro .NET. Tento výkonný nástroj nejen zjednodušuje převod dokumentů, ale také se hladce integruje s různými aplikacemi .NET.

Další kroky

Zvažte prozkoumání dalších funkcí knihovny GroupDocs, jako je například převod různých formátů souborů nebo rozšíření možností vaší aktuální aplikace pomocí dalších konverzí.

Jste připraveni to vyzkoušet? Přejděte do sekce s našimi zdroji níže, kde najdete další informace a podporu!

Sekce Často kladených otázek

  1. .FODS číslo volby
    • FODS je zkratka pro „Form of Document Specification“ (Formu specifikace dokumentu). Obvykle se používá v systémech správy dokumentů.
  2. Mohu převést více souborů najednou pomocí GroupDocs.Conversion?
    • Ano, můžete implementovat dávkové zpracování pro efektivní práci s více soubory.
  3. Jaké jsou systémové požadavky pro spuštění GroupDocs.Conversion v .NET?
    • Ujistěte se, že vaše prostředí podporuje verze .NET Framework nebo .NET Core kompatibilní s knihovnami GroupDocs.
  4. Existuje nějaký limit velikosti souboru, který lze převést?
    • I když neexistuje žádný pevný limit, výkon se může lišit v závislosti na možnostech systému a složitosti souborů.
  5. Jak mám řešit chyby v konverzi?
    • Pro efektivní správu výjimek implementujte bloky try-catch kolem logiky konverze.

Zdroje

Začněte s převodem dokumentů ještě dnes s GroupDocs.Conversion pro .NET a zažijte snadnost automatizované správy dokumentů!